Recognizing the Gift in Grace

Facing uncertainty when you “think“ you’re alone feeds our fear and greed. When we can surrender the illusion of being alone, of not being supported, not being loved… we can open and allow grace. I have found it helpful to review all those times in my life when this body should’ve been ended had it not been for grace given. With awareness to the power and gift of grace I’m fortified to meet the moment with a whole heart, with diminished fear and a sense of satisfaction that feeds joy. With awareness to the direct experience of grace and the opportunity to participate in this precious birth, the quality of life improves and our natural tendency to complain and fuel dissatisfaction dissipates.

Given this precious birth, it’s our responsibility to show up, pay attention and take on the difficult task of being our best. We can get lost in our desire “to have“, we can fail to meet the situation at our best when we lack awareness to the harm we may cause. This is why it’s so important to balance “have“, “do“ and “be“. With awareness practice we can find our grounding and carry an upright posture, knowing we’re giving our whole attention to the moment as we stretch further and further into our best. We can be distracted by those who would put us to sleep to the core of our being. There are those who would justify inflicting violence on others so that they could achieve more wealth and power. It’s only when we recognize the truth that we are each other, that our work is that of stewardship and compassion, that we can touch that space of showing up with full attention, being our best. Finally, it’s important to hold self compassion as we often miss the mark. We have to rest our foolish pride, knowing we don’t control the results.
